<P>PROBLEM TO BE SOLVED: To provide a polarization optical element and a true-zero order wavelength plate that function in an UV region by using material and production approach different from conventional ones. <P>SOLUTION: Birefringence porous silicon is oxidized to produce birefringence porous silica. Further, the degree of refractive index anisotropy of the porous silica is controlled by controlling an oxidizing condition. By controlling film thickness and the degree of refractive index anisotropy, a wavelength plate is produced, which functions at a target wavelength that functions in the UV region. The oxidizing condition and refractive index anisotropy have correlation. The oxidizing anneal temperature is controlled so as to be 800 to 1000°C, thereby obtaining birefringence porous silica that has less refractive index anisotropy. <P>COPYRIGHT: (C)2012,JPO&INPIT |
